Espanyol in talks with Getafe coach Laudrup

Espanyol have held talks with Getafe coach Michael Laudrup.

DiarioSport says the Dane has emerged as Espanyol's top choice to succeed Ernesto Valverde, who left the club this week. Espanyol have turned to Laudrup after being turned down by former Racing Santander coach Marcelino.

The stumbling block to any deal, however, could be Laudrup's insistence he bring his entire Getafe backroom team to Espanyol - his three assistants, John Jensen, Erik Larsesen and Luis Milla, his goalkeeper coach, Juan Carlos Arevalo and his fitness coach, Oscar Antonio Garcia.
